Specifications

The Boekel Water Bath 6L 230V 290100-2 comes with a 6L capacity, which is a very practical size for many standard laboratory procedures. It operates on a 230V power supply, common in many laboratory settings and workshops. The temperature range is specified as ambient plus 10°C to 100°C, offering flexibility for various heating needs, including the ability to reach a boiling mode.

A key feature is the user-programmed timer, which can be set for up to 99 hours. This timer allows the heater to automatically switch off once the set time elapses, providing a critical safety and convenience feature, especially for long incubations. The unit’s construction appears to be primarily stainless steel for the inner chamber, promoting durability and ease of cleaning, while the outer casing is likely a coated metal designed for longevity.

Accessories and Customization Options

The Boekel Water Bath 6L 230V 290100-2 typically comes with a removable stainless steel lid. This lid is designed to reduce evaporation and heat loss, featuring an angled design to allow condensed water to drip back into the bath. There are no other significant accessories typically included, and customization options are minimal, which is consistent with its straightforward design.

While you can’t “customize” the unit itself, its standard 6L capacity is compatible with a wide range of laboratory glassware like beakers, flasks, and culture dishes of appropriate size. The 230V operation means it’s ready for use in most standard lab power setups without needing a converter.
